Reading a Gtbet promotion before you opt in

A welcome offer is usually described by two headline numbers: a percentage match and a ceiling on how much of that match will be credited. Both matter, because the percentage tells you the rate and the ceiling tells you where it stops paying out. A free-spins count sits alongside most casino offers, and it is worth checking which games those spins apply to before assuming they cover the library at large. Where a bonus does not publish a minimum deposit, an expiry window, or a maximum stake while it is active, those conditions still exist in the operator's full terms — this page states only what we could confirm.

The sportsbook welcome bonus

The sports offer is a straightforward 500% match, capped at €1,500, plus 200 free spins. Worked through with real numbers: a €100 deposit at 500% would in principle return €500 in bonus funds, well under the cap. A €300 deposit at 500% would calculate to €1,500 — exactly the ceiling Gtbet states — so anything deposited above that point stops adding to the match.

The numbers behind the offer

Match-percentage offers are common across the market, and headline figures like 500% sit well above what most operators advertise — typically somewhere in the 100–200% range for a first deposit. A high percentage is only worth as much as the cap it sits under, though: the €1,500 ceiling on Gtbet's sports offer means the practical value plateaus at a €300 deposit regardless of how much more is added afterwards. The referral bonus works on a similar logic — up to €1,000 per person invited — but "up to" signals a ceiling rather than a fixed amount, and the operator's own terms will set out how that figure scales in practice.

Playing within your limits

Promotions are designed to encourage deposits and continued play, and it is worth treating any bonus as entertainment value rather than an expected return. Players in the Netherlands who want support around their gambling can contact Open over gokken free and anonymously on 0800 24 000 22, or register with Cruks, the national self-exclusion register run by the Kansspelautoriteit. Registering with Cruks blocks access to Dutch-licensed operators specifically, not every gambling site on the internet. Gambling is only ever available to adults aged 18+.
